Class CacheActiveDirectorySettingsArgs
- java.lang.Object
-
- com.pulumi.resources.InputArgs
-
- com.pulumi.resources.ResourceArgs
-
- com.pulumi.azurenative.storagecache.inputs.CacheActiveDirectorySettingsArgs
-
public final class CacheActiveDirectorySettingsArgs extends com.pulumi.resources.ResourceArgs
Active Directory settings used to join a cache to a domain.
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
CacheActiveDirectorySettingsArgs.Builder
-
Field Summary
Fields Modifier and Type Field Description static CacheActiveDirectorySettingsArgs
Empty
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static CacheActiveDirectorySettingsArgs.Builder
builder()
static CacheActiveDirectorySettingsArgs.Builder
builder(CacheActiveDirectorySettingsArgs defaults)
com.pulumi.core.Output<java.lang.String>
cacheNetBiosName()
java.util.Optional<com.pulumi.core.Output<CacheActiveDirectorySettingsCredentialsArgs>>
credentials()
com.pulumi.core.Output<java.lang.String>
domainName()
com.pulumi.core.Output<java.lang.String>
domainNetBiosName()
com.pulumi.core.Output<java.lang.String>
primaryDnsIpAddress()
java.util.Optional<com.pulumi.core.Output<java.lang.String>>
secondaryDnsIpAddress()
-
-
-
Field Detail
-
Empty
public static final CacheActiveDirectorySettingsArgs Empty
-
-
Method Detail
-
cacheNetBiosName
public com.pulumi.core.Output<java.lang.String> cacheNetBiosName()
- Returns:
- The NetBIOS name to assign to the HPC Cache when it joins the Active Directory domain as a server. Length must 1-15 characters from the class [-0-9a-zA-Z].
-
credentials
public java.util.Optional<com.pulumi.core.Output<CacheActiveDirectorySettingsCredentialsArgs>> credentials()
- Returns:
- Active Directory admin credentials used to join the HPC Cache to a domain.
-
domainName
public com.pulumi.core.Output<java.lang.String> domainName()
- Returns:
- The fully qualified domain name of the Active Directory domain controller.
-
domainNetBiosName
public com.pulumi.core.Output<java.lang.String> domainNetBiosName()
- Returns:
- The Active Directory domain's NetBIOS name.
-
primaryDnsIpAddress
public com.pulumi.core.Output<java.lang.String> primaryDnsIpAddress()
- Returns:
- Primary DNS IP address used to resolve the Active Directory domain controller's fully qualified domain name.
-
secondaryDnsIpAddress
public java.util.Optional<com.pulumi.core.Output<java.lang.String>> secondaryDnsIpAddress()
- Returns:
- Secondary DNS IP address used to resolve the Active Directory domain controller's fully qualified domain name.
-
builder
public static CacheActiveDirectorySettingsArgs.Builder builder()
-
builder
public static CacheActiveDirectorySettingsArgs.Builder builder(CacheActiveDirectorySettingsArgs defaults)
-
-